In 1926 Oakland produced only three of these special 4-door Sport
Phaetons Convertible for export.

Specifications:
Color: Optional
Seating Capacity: Five
Wheelbase: 113 inches
Wheels: Natural Wood
Tires: 30 x 5.25 inches, full balloon
Brakes: Foot, contracting on four wheels
Engine: Six cylinder, vertical, cast in block 2 7/8 x 4 3/4 inches;
head removable; values in side; horsepower 19.84 N.A.C.C. rating
Lubrication: Full pressure
Crankshaft: Three bearings, with harmonic balancer
Radiator: Cellular
Cooling: Water pump
Ignition: Storage battery, automatic
Starting System: Two unit
Voltage: Six to eight
Wiring System: Single
Gasoline System: Vacuum
Clutch: Single plate
Transmission: Selective sliding
Drive: Spiral bevel
Rear Springs: Semi-elliptic
Rear Axle: Semi-floating
Steering Gear: Screw and split nut
